The MSX is home to all sorts of interesting RPGs that Woomb.net is busy translating for a new generation to play and there are also quirky titles like Teachers Terror where you fight back against your students. Think of the game as the anti-Bully where instead of playing a kid at school you’re a teacher who has to hit their students with projectiles before suffering a mental breakdown. If your students drive you bonkers enough your stress level raises into the red and the screen bounces or starts to blur. To top it off the game is played like Dunk Hunt or Operation Wolf where your targets pop up to get hit. It’s an interesting concept, one that no one else has picked up and it looks like the MSX catalog may have some more worthy surprises in the future.
